CSS3頂層是CSS中非常重要的一部分,用于定義在重疊的元素上,哪個元素應該位于頂部,哪個元素位于底部。在沒有頂層屬性的情況下,元素是按照它們在HTML文檔中出現(xiàn)的順序進行堆疊的。
.example { position: relative; z-index: 1; } .another-example { position: absolute; z-index: 2; }
在上面的代碼示例中,`.example`元素的`z-index`屬性設(shè)置為1,`.another-example`元素的`z-index`屬性設(shè)置為2。那么,`.another-example`元素將被放置在`.example`元素之上,因為它的`z-index`屬性值更高。
如果兩個元素具有相同的`z-index`屬性值,則它們將根據(jù)它們在HTML文檔中出現(xiàn)的順序進行堆疊。對于具有負`z-index`值的元素,它們將被放置在正`z-index`值的元素的下面。
使用`z-index`屬性可以幫助您控制HTML文檔中各個元素的顯示順序,從而提高用戶體驗并為網(wǎng)站或應用程序增加交互性。